Dar es Salaam Water and Sewerage Authority (DAWASA) was established under the DAWASA Act No. 20 of 2001 with an overall responsibility of supplying Water and Sewerage Services to Dar es Salaam, Kibaha and Bagamoyo and along the two transmission mains i.e from Upper Ruvu and Lower Ruvu to Dar es Salaam. Asset Management is very crucial if DAWASA as a water utility is to achieve its goal of satisfying the demand of water and sewerage services to its designated customers. DAWASA Asset Engineer has the overall responsibility of ensuring the optimization of the usage of the water supply and sewerage infrastructure, seeing to it that the maintenance cost of the infrastructure is kept at its possible minimum level, while avoiding operational risks and service interruptions through effective monitoring of its usage. As the Engineer of the Utility Assets, the job entails planning for the renewal of the infrastructure in accordance with its designated life time and also endeavours to have a water supply infrastructure with acceptable minimal physical leakage levels.
Duties and Responsibilities:
a) Assists in maintaining the general asset register and network model and advising on timely interventions.
b) Ensures that Asset Management project objectives and time lines are met.
c) Preparing and maintaining hydraulic/network model for DAWASA assets management function, deployment and use within the organization.
d) By the usage of engineering software, such as AutoCAD, Water CAD, Sewer CAD, GIS, GPS & GPRS effectively monitors the Utility infrastructure and prepares Auto CAD drawings for the existing assets and updates the existing drawings to capture new developments.
e) Validates time to time physical and condition data for all DAWASA assets for the purpose of up-to-date quality data, to be delivered for the GIS.
f) Coordinating with The OPERATOR to ensure accurate customers base maps are available.
g) Liaises with the consultants on asset valuation assignments
h) Prepares Terms of Reference for asset valuation consultants.
i) . Serves as a liaison with the GIS and Block Mapping department of the OPERATOR ensuring reliability of the Operator's daily data entries.
j) Reviews reports submitted by the asset valuation consultants.
k) Liaise with the Operator on data entries in relation to system improvements and through periodical surveys, monitors the performance of the existing water networks, valves and tapping points of customers to ensure they are in line with the standards as set in the lease agreement.
I) Registers new assets.
m) Maintains asset data and asset network plans.
n) Monitors asset condition and fitness for water supply and sewerage service purposes and propose replacement plan.
0) Implementation of integrated asset management.
